RCA double adapters
Just how bad is an RCA double adapter on sound quality?

I have two turntables and only one input in the phono stage.
An adapter like this allows me to use both turntables without plugging and unplugging. I think it reduces the strength of the input signal - but hard to measure. Will it reduce audio quality?
Is it rare for a phono stage to have more than one RCA input?
